Vertical conveyor boosted Alfaroc’s warehouse efficiency

Alfaroc Logistics Oy is a Finnish company specializing in warehousing and in-house logistics solutions. The company offers its customers comprehensive warehousing services, internal logistics operations, and 3PL solutions, along with value-added services such as labeling, packaging, and assembly. Alfaroc operates in Päijät-Häme, Tuusula, Vantaa, Järvenpää, and Rauma.

Challenge: slow and labor-intensive picking process

Alfaroc utilizes mezzanines in its warehouses for picking small goods and providing value-added services. Before implementing Ferroplan’s solution, full pallets were lifted to the mezzanine using forklifts. After picking up or value-added services, individual packages were lowered one by one back to the ground floor, again using a forklift. The process was slow and consumed both time and forklift capacity.

“Lowering packages always required a reach truck and a driver, making the process inefficient and frustratingly complex,” explains Lasse Tarvainen, Chief Operating Officer at Alfaroc.

Solution: Ferroplan’s vertical conveyor and roller conveyors

To streamline its warehouse operations, Alfaroc selected an Interroll vertical conveyor solution delivered by Ferroplan, which is equipped with roller conveyors. The new solution enables packages to move directly from the mezzanine to the ground-floor dispatch area without requiring unnecessary intermediate steps or the use of a forklift. The vertical conveyor also allows goods to be moved from the ground floor back to the mezzanine, adding flexibility to daily operations.

The vertical conveyor is now an integrated part of Alfaroc’s small goods picking process. It has significantly accelerated work and freed up forklift capacity for other tasks.

“We have streamlined our operations. We save working time, and occupational safety has improved, as the heavy and complicated task of lowering goods with a reach truck is no longer necessary. Packages are now moved down safely and efficiently,” Tarvainen sums up.

Although no precise figures have yet been measured, practical experience shows that the vertical conveyor has already improved efficiency and workflow. As volumes grow, the benefits are expected to increase even further.
